Marantz CD-16D
¥ 160,000 (released in 1997)
Commentary
A CD player equipped with a digital input / output terminal.
The mechanism part is equipped with linear tracking mechanism CDM 12.1.
The D/A converter uses a bit stream D/A converter Triple 7.
It is equipped with a balanced output amplifier using Marantz's newly developed Dual HDAM.
Uses a copper-plated die-cast chassis, a 3-mm-thick copper-plated steel plate base plate, and a 3-mm-thick aluminum top cover.
Comes with an aluminum top remote controller that can control the output level.
Model Rating
Type | CD Player |
Input / output terminal | Digital coaxial output : 1 system Digital optical output : 1 system Analog unbalanced output : 1 system Analog balance output : 1 system Digital coaxial input : 1 system Digital optical input : 1 system |
Frequency characteristic | 20 Hz to 20 kHz ± 0.3 dB |
Dynamic range | 98 dB or more |
Signal-to-noise ratio | 110dB |
Channel separation | 103dB(1kHz) |
Total harmonic distortion factor | 0.0015%(1kHz) |
Audio output | 2.2Vrms |
Sampling frequency | CD mode : 44.1 kHz DA mode : 32 kHz, 44.1 kHz, 48 kHz |
Power consumption | 16W (Electrical Appliance and Material Control Law) |
Maximum external dimensions | Width 458x Height 110x Depth 369 mm |
Weight | 11.0kg |
Attachment | Wireless Remote Control |
